​Arteta Cautions That Arsenal Remains in the EPL Title Contention    

 

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ta is confident that his team remains in contention for the Premier League title, even though they are currently 11 points behind league leaders Liverpool. The Gunners sit in second place with 53 points, while Liverpool leads with 64 points. Arsenal faced a significant setback in their title chase after losing 1-0 to West Ham United at the Emirates Stadium on Saturday. Liverpool capitalized on this by defeating Manchester City 2-0 at the Etihad Stadium the next day. Arsenal aims to revive their title hopes on Wednesday against Nottingham Forest at the City Ground. In his pre-match press conference on Tuesday, Arteta emphasized that his team should not be counted out. When asked if Arsenal had given up on the title, Arteta firmly responded: “Over my dead body.” When asked once more if he truly believes Arsenal can achieve it, the Spaniard replied: “If not, I’ll head home.” From a mathematical perspective, it’s feasible. “You are present, and you must participate in every game.” Out of nowhere, three days ago, we were able to bridge the gap, and now you’re just one and a half games behind. It’s inconsequential. “We must keep moving forward.” The Gunners aim to continue their superiority against Forest when they face off on Wednesday. In their previous three matchups, Arteta has guided his team to victory each time.
